Alberta Hate Crimes Committee aims to clear up confusion between hate incidents and hate crimes

When a man tied a rope into a noose, dangled it from his hand and told two Muslim women, “This is for you” before singing O Canada at the University LRT station in November, city police easily identified the event as a hate incident.
Labelling it a hate crime proved much more difficult.
“Was it a hate incident? You bet. The girls felt intimidated,” said Sgt. Gary Willits of the Edmonton Police Service hate crimes unit.
